Question:
A patient is consulted with ENT on 6/20/16 due to hx of SMA type 1 and evaluation for tracheostomy. They state that they will plan for tracheostomy on 6/22/16. I can bill for the consult on 6/20/16, but could I also bill for the subsequent visit on 6/22/16 with a 25 modifier?

It really depends on what is documented on 6/22/16. Since the workup and decision for the procedure was already made, a separate E&M on the day of the procedure would only be appropriate if there was significant and separately identifiable E&M, e.g. if there had been a change in the patient's condition requiring new E&M or if the provider was managing other problems unrelated to the procedure at the same time.
